DOBON.NET DOBON.NETプログラミング掲示板過去ログ

datagridの「*」行の選択状態の取得

環境/言語:[WINXP、VB.NET2003]
分類:[.NET]

datagridの一番下の行が「*」のマークになっているときに
その行を選択した状態で、CTRLキー+Cキー をクリックすると
「'System.IndexOutOfRangeException' の初回例外が system.windows.forms.dll で発生しました。」
のエラーが発生してしまいます。

この「*」状態の行を選択しているかどうかを
判別するにはどうすればよいですか?

もしくは、このエラーを無視させたいのですが、
どこにエラーハンドルを書けばいいのかわかりません。

どなたかご教示お願いします。
> この「*」状態の行を選択しているかどうかを
> 判別するにはどうすればよいですか?

自己解決しました。

DataGrid1.IsSelected(DataSet11.mstNISHA.Rows.Count)
で選択状態を取得して、最終行を選択していたら
Unselectで選択解除させます。
解決済みをチェックし忘れました。
解決済み!

DOBON.NET | プログラミング道 | プログラミング掲示板